A self-assembled trimeric ring-shaped aggregate of an alu-minium(III) porphyrin bearing a benzoic acid in one meso-position has been characterized by NMR-spectroscopy and MALDI-TOF spectrometry.Cyclic multiporphyrin systems are interesting assemblies because of their resemblance to the natural light-harvesting system.Both covalent as well as supramolecular approaches have been used to construct such cyclic porphyrin arrays.
